To keep this review short, this one-shot is just really cute. It's essentially a romance one-shot that somewhat explores the relationship between Minato Namikaze and Kushina Uzumaki, the parents of main series protagonist Naruto Uzumaki. I really like the dynamic between the two of them in this story, and the little bits of substance that get added are nice touches. Nothing ground-breaking happens, but for a single extended chapter about two characters who are dead in the main story (hurts to say it), it's a nice quick read. It's only about 55 pages, which is roughly the length of the first chapter of most manga stories, so I'd recommend trying it out for yourself, especially if you want to see more of Naruto's parents.
As for complaints, my main one is that there isn't much to either of them here besides liking each other, especially on Kushina's part. There are some nice flashbacks to her talking with Mito Uzumaki, the prior jinchuriki for Kurama, though they get a little repetitive with Mito saying the same thing over and over again. On a much, much smaller gripe, the story is set sometime before Minato became the mentor of Kakashi, Rin, and Obito. I would've liked to see the four of them interact a little, although their absence is more of an "I wish" than an "I dislike."
Other than those two details, I'd still recommend reading this for yourself. It's very cute, and I hope Kishimoto does more of these one-shots for characters in the future.
